Welcome to the Start of User Mastery
Welcome! Who am I? What Is User Mastery? How does this help you?
13 October 2025 — Dave Cheong
Banner

Hi, I’m Dave!

I'm a dad of two and I run a bespoke software development company here in Sydney, Australia. Over the years, I've worked with many clients, from small startups to big enterprises and government agencies. I've noticed all product teams share the same challenges:
Communicating effectively with their users.
After years of watching teams cobble together clunky solutions from multiple tools, I've wondered if there is a better way. It turns out, not really.
That's why I'm building the better way!
User Mastery — the unified platform for product teams to announce updates, maintain a changelog, share roadmaps, provide help documentation and collect feedback.

What is User Mastery?

In simple terms, User Mastery is a platform designed to help product teams manage their relationship with users. I'm building tools that make it easier to create beautiful changelogs, announce updates, gather feedback, manage roadmaps, maintain helpful documentation and collect testimonials—all in one place.
Think of it as your command centre for user engagement. If you're a solo founder, a small startup, or a growing product team, then User Mastery is for you. It’ll give you the tools you need to keep your users informed, engaged, and excited about what you're building.
My goal is to help product teams tell users about new features (so they actually use them), gather meaningful feedback (so they build the right things), share plans (so users know what's coming), and provide help (so users don't get stuck).

My Build in Public Manifesto

Here's the thing: I believe in radical transparency. That's why I'm committed to building User Mastery in public.
What does that mean? It means you'll see everything—the wins, the struggles, the pivots, and the lessons learned along the way. I'll be sharing:
  • Our product roadmap and what features we're prioritising (and why)
  • Real metrics—user numbers, revenue, challenges we're facing
  • Behind-the-scenes decisions about positioning, pricing, and product direction
  • Honest reflections on what's working and what's not
Why build in public? Because I think the best products are built with their communities, not just for them. By sharing our journey openly, I hope to:
  • Get valuable feedback from people who actually care
  • Build trust through transparency
  • Inspire other founders and makers who are on similar journeys
  • Create a community of people who are invested in our success

How This Will Help Product Teams

If you're building a product, you know the struggle:
  • You ship a new feature but half your users don't even know about it
  • Users ask "what's coming next?" and you're scrambling to update a Google Doc
  • Your help docs are scattered across multiple platforms
  • Collecting and organising user feedback feels like herding cats

Join Me on This Journey

This is just the beginning. Over the coming weeks and months, I'll be sharing updates, lessons learned, and milestones as we build User Mastery together.
If you're a product person, a founder, or just someone who cares about building better products, I'd love for you to follow along. Your feedback, questions, and ideas will help shape what User Mastery becomes. This blog is built using User Mastery, so let me know if you see any problems!

Comments (0)

Communicate product updates & roadmaps, write awesome help documentation, collect feature requests and user testimonials— zero fuss.

Sign up for free today and receive priority access to new features, exclusive lifetime pricing when we launch, better limits on all plans and have your say in how we develop User Mastery.